HOW TO USE THIS SET OF SLIDES
• The FLW Standard provides consistent language for describing the scope of an FLW
inventory.
• The Standard does not prescribe a particular definition for “food loss and waste.”
Rather it defines what the possible components of “food loss and waste” could be in
terms of possible material types (i.e., food and/or associated inedible parts) and
destinations (where material removed from the food supply chain is directed). It
allows an entity to select which combination of material types and destinations it
considers to be “food loss and waste”
• We have created a template to graphically show the 5 dimensions of scope (including
possible components of “material type” and “destinations”)
• These slides show you how to customize this template and create a graphic that you
can use to easily describe your scope using the FLW Standard
• Also included in this set of slides is a sample showing how you can use this template
to describe the scope
• The Appendix includes definitions (material types, destinations and the boundary),
the 8 reporting requirements, and FLW Standard’s Table of Contents

HOW TO EDIT GRAPHIC*
1. MATERIAL TYPES AND DESTINATIONS –
Color in the boxes only for material type(s) and destination(s) that are included.
TO COLOR A BOX:
Animal Feed 1. Select shape, go to “Format”
2. Go to “Shape Fill” and select “Gold, lighter 80%” from “Theme colors”**
3. Go to “Shape Outline” and select “Green” from “Theme colors”**
4. Make edits to relevant text. Highlight text and select “Black” from “Font colors”
** These colors should be available on most versions of PowerPoint.
Inedible parts TO “GREY-OUT” BOX IF NOT IN SCOPE:
1. Select shape, go to “Format”
2. Go to “Shape Fill” and select “No Fill” or “White” from “Theme colors”
3. Go to “Shape Outline” and select “Grey” from “Theme colors”
4. The text uses the same “Grey” as the shape outline
2. CHECKMARK –
Use check mark only for colored boxes (for material types and destinations)
• This symbol can be copy & pasted for reuse.
• You can also adjust the color. For example, if a destination is included in the scope of the
inventory but no FLW goes to that destination, you may change the color of the check mark for
that destination to be “beige.”
* For definitions and additional guidance, refer to the Appendix of this file and Chapter 6 of the FLW Standard.
